Warrant service leads to felony arrests

- Cash and suspected marijuana was seized during a house search Saturday night in Barren County.
While Barren County sheriff’s deputies were serving a warrant at 10:31 p.m. Saturday at 2096 Beckton Road, a subsequent search led to three people being arrested on felony drug charges.
While inside the home, deputies smelled the odor of marijuana and found a marijuana cigarette, according to a release from the sheriff’s office.
Deputies obtained a search warrant on the home and said they found about 8.5 pounds of marijuana, cash and drug paraphernalia.
Kenneth E. Wilson, 79, Rebecca S. Wilson, 53, and James T. Martin Jr., 55, all of Glasgow, were arrested and charged with trafficking in marijuana over 5 pounds and possession of marijuana and lodged in the Barren County Corrections Center, according to the release. Rebecca Wilson and Martin are additionally charged with possession of drug paraphernalia, according to online jail records.
All three were released Sunday on $5,000 cash bonds each.
